New International Reader’s Version

Colossians 3:1-25

Teachings About Holy Living

1You have been raised up with Christ. So think about things that are in heaven. That is where Christ is. He is sitting at God’s right hand. 2Think about things that are in heaven. Don’t think about things that are only on earth. 3You died. Now your life is hidden with Christ in God. 4Christ is your life. When he appears again, you also will appear with him in heaven’s glory.

5So put to death anything that comes from sinful desires. Get rid of sexual sins and impure acts. Don’t let your feelings get out of control. Remove from your life all evil desires. Stop always wanting more and more. You might as well be worshiping statues of gods. 6God’s anger is going to come because of these things. 7That’s the way you lived at one time in your life. 8But now here are the kinds of things you must also get rid of. You must get rid of anger, rage, hate and lies. Let no dirty words come out of your mouths. 9Don’t lie to one another. You have gotten rid of your old way of life and its habits. 10You have started living a new life. Your knowledge of how that life should have the Creator’s likeness is being made new. 11Here there is no Gentile or Jew. There is no difference between those who are circumcised and those who are not. There is no rude outsider, or even a Scythian. There is no slave or free person. But Christ is everything. And he is in everything.

12You are God’s chosen people. You are holy and dearly loved. So put on tender mercy and kindness as if they were your clothes. Don’t be proud. Be gentle and patient. 13Put up with one another. Forgive one another if you are holding something against someone. Forgive, just as the Lord forgave you. 14And over all these good things put on love. Love holds them all together perfectly as if they were one.

15Let the peace that Christ gives rule in your hearts. As parts of one body, you were appointed to live in peace. And be thankful. 16Let the message about Christ live among you like a rich treasure. Teach and correct one another wisely. Teach one another by singing psalms and hymns and songs from the Spirit. Sing to God with thanks in your hearts. 17Do everything you say or do in the name of the Lord Jesus. Always give thanks to God the Father through Christ.

Teachings About Christian Families

18Wives, follow the lead of your husbands. That’s what the Lord wants you to do.

19Husbands, love your wives. Don’t be mean to them.

20Children, obey your parents in everything. That pleases the Lord.

21Fathers, don’t make your children bitter. If you do, they will lose hope.

22Slaves, obey your earthly masters in everything. Don’t do it just to please them when they are watching you. Obey them with an honest heart. Do it out of respect for the Lord. 23Work at everything you do with all your heart. Work as if you were working for the Lord, not for human masters. 24Work because you know that you will finally receive as a reward what the Lord wants you to have. You are slaves of the Lord Christ. 25Anyone who does wrong will be paid back for what they do. God treats everyone the same.

Akuapem Twi Contemporary Bible

Kolosefo 3:1-25

Ma Ɔsoro Nyɛ Wo Dadwen

1Wɔanyan mo ne Kristo aba nkwa mu. Afei munnwen ɔsoro nneɛma ho, faako a Kristo te, Onyankopɔn nifa so, di hene no. 2Saa nneɛma no na momma mo adwene nkɔ so, na ɛnyɛ asase yi so nneɛma. 3Efisɛ moawu na wɔde mo nkwa ne Kristo ahintaw wɔ Onyankopɔn mu. 4Na sɛ Kristo a ɔyɛ mo nkwa no ba a, mo ne no bɛba wɔ nʼanuonyam mu.

Nkwa Dedaw Ne Nkwa Foforo

5Munyi wiase akɔnnɔ te sɛ aguamammɔ, afideyɛ, bɔne, ne anibere a ɛyɛ abosonsom no mfi mo abrabɔ mu. 6Eyinom nti Onyankopɔn abufuw reba. 7Bere bi a atwam no, esiane mo akɔnnɔ nti na mobɔ saa bra yi. 8Afei munnyae saa nneyɛe yi nyinaa: abufuw, bɔnepɛ, ne ɔtan. Monnyeyaw obi anaa mommma kasa a ɛho ntew mmfi mo anom. 9Munnnidi atoro nkyerɛ mo ho mo ho, efisɛ moatow nipadua dedaw ne ne su no akyene 10de nipadua foforo asi anan mu. Moayɛ nnipa afoforo a daa Onyankopɔn a ɔbɔɔ mo no resakra mo wɔ ne suban so, sɛnea ɛbɛyɛ a Onyankopɔn ho nimdeɛ bɛhyɛ mo ma. 11Esiane saa nti, amanamanmufo ne Yudafo, twetiatwafo ne momonotoyɛ, awudifo, nkoa ne wɔn a wɔde wɔn ho no nni hɔ bio. Kristo wɔ biribiara mu. Kristo te yɛn nyinaa mu.

12Moyɛ Onyankopɔn nkurɔfo. Ɔpɛ mo asɛm nti na oyii mo sɛ ne de, enti monyɛ timmɔbɔ, ayamye, mommrɛ mo ho ase, munnwo na monyɛ abodwokyɛre. 13Mommoaboa mo ho mo ho na momfa mo ho mo ho mfomso nkyekyɛ mo ho mo ho. Momfa nkyɛ sɛnea Awurade de kyɛ mo no. 14Eyi nyinaa akyi no, momfa ɔdɔ a ɛde koroyɛ ba no nka mo abrabɔ ho.

15Momma Kristo asomdwoe no ntena mo koma mu. Saa asomdwoe yi ho na wɔafrɛ mo nyinaa aba Kristo nipadua koro mu. Monyɛ nnipa a wɔwɔ ayeyi. 16Kristo asɛm no ne mu nnepa nyinaa ntena mo koma mu. Momfa nyansa nkyerɛkyerɛ. Monto asanku so nnwom ne ayeyi nnwom ne honhom mu nnwom. Mumfi mo koma mu nto aseda nnwom mma Onyankopɔn. 17Biribiara a moyɛ anaa moka no, monyɛ wɔ Awurade Yesu din mu na momfa ne so nna Agya Onyankopɔn ase.

Ayɔnkofa Pa

18Ɔyerenom, mommrɛ mo ho ase mma mo kununom sɛnea ɛsɛ wɔ Awurade mu.

19Okununom, monnodɔ mo yerenom na monnhyɛ wɔn ahometew.

20Mma, ade nyinaa mu, muntie mo awofo asɛm na eyi na ɛsɔ Onyankopɔn ani.

21Agyanom, munnyi mo mma abufuw na ammu wɔn aba mu.

22Asomfo, muntie mo wuranom asɛm wɔ ade nyinaa mu. Ɛnyɛ sɛ wɔn ani tua mo nti na ɛsɛ sɛ moyɛ na wɔpene mo, na mmom esiane sɛ mudi Awurade ni no nti, momfa koma pa nyɛ. 23Biribiara a moyɛ no, momfa mo koma nyinaa nyɛ na momfa no sɛ moreyɛ ama Awurade na monnyɛ mma nnipa. 24Monkae sɛ Awurade bɛkyɛ mo so ade. Mo nsa bɛka ade a ɔde asie ama ne nkurɔfo no bi. Kristo ne owura a mosom no. 25Na obiara a ɔyɛ nea ɛnteɛ no, bɔne a ɔyɛ no so akatua na obenya a nhwɛanim biara nni mu.
